The history of the bbq roasting box “caja china” has been said to go back to mid-19th Century Cuba and the arrival of Chinese laborers. But looking a little deeper seems to bring into questions how much of the stories that have been passed down are fact, and how much is fiction.

Ever Smoke A Coconut? For centuries people in Indonesia have recognized the use of coconut shells not only as a natural raw material to produce handicrafts but also as an alternative and supplement to traditional lump charcoal to improve and prolong the heat produced for cooking.
